Acquiring An Unsecured Credit Card After Bankruptcy

Should you have ever gone via the financially detrimental bankruptcy method, you may possibly be wondering if you will ever be able to get your credit back on a positive track once more. Fortunately, it is achievable to get an unsecured credit card after filing for bankruptcy.

You will find two vital things to remember when applying for an unsecured credit card after a bankruptcy. 1, your credit limit might be particularly low. Two, your interest rate will probably be fairly high. The credit card company offering you an unsecured credit cards knows that, after a bankruptcy, you might be considered financially high risk. Thus, they need to minimize the risk that they’ve to endure by making certain you pay high fees and have a low credit limit. In order to keep these fees down to a manageable level for your income, you’ll need to compare credit lenders by the interest rate and fees they are offering you.

Additionally, the application method for an unsecured credit card after bankruptcy is normally extensive. The credit card organization will desire to speak with your present employer to verify income. Plus, you can expect to be charged a high application fee and high annual fees for the privilege of utilizing the unsecured credit card.

When applying for an unsecured credit card after a bankruptcy, it’s very critical to be entirely honest with the lender. Let them know that you might have made past financial mistakes but are the path to a positive financial history. Pay on time every and every month and don’t utilize more than 30% of your credit limit. In the event you show that you’re on the path to credit worthiness within the future by making all your payments on time, they’ll possibly reward you with a higher credit limit.
